The Evolution of Modern Sofas

Sofas have actually come a long method from the conventional designs of earlier centuries. The 20th century saw considerable advancements in furniture design, paving the way for modern aesthetics that focus on minimalism, performance, and convenience. The increase of Mid-Century Modern style in the 1950s emphasized clean lines, organic shapes, and innovative products, which continue to affect modern sofa styles today.

Product Choices in Modern Sofas

The selection of materials plays a crucial function in the visual appeals and functionality of modern sofas. Below are some of the most popular materials used in sofa style:

1. Fabric

Fabric sofas use different textures and colors, enabling a personalized touch. Common material options include:

  • Cotton: Breathable, soft, and available in many prints and colors. However, it may stain easily without treatment.
  • Linen: Known for its elegant look, linen is long lasting however can wrinkle and stain.
  • Microfiber: Stain-resistant and simple to tidy, making it appropriate for families.
  • Velvet: Luxurious and soft, perfect for including a touch of beauty but requires routine upkeep.

2. Leather

Leather sofas are associated with luxury and durability. They are simple to tidy, age magnificently, and can fit into both modern and traditional settings. However, they can be more costly and might require conditioning to maintain their quality.

3. Artificial Materials

Sofas made from synthetic products, such as faux leather or polyester, can mimic the appearance of genuine leather or fabric. They are generally more budget friendly and easier to keep but might not have the exact same durability.

Trends in Modern Sofa Design

The world of modern sofas is continuously developing, with new patterns emerging each year. Here are some significant trends shaping modern sofa design:

1. Sustainability

As environmental consciousness boosts, numerous producers are prioritizing environment-friendly products and sustainable practices. Sofas made from recycled materials or sustainably sourced lumber are acquiring popularity.

2. Modular Designs

Modular sofas, which consist of multiple interchangeable areas, offer flexibility and customization. They are best for adjusting to different areas and choices, allowing house owners to alter the layout as required.

3. Strong Colors and Patterns

While neutral colors have long dominated the sofa market, there's an increasing trend towards bold colors and striking patterns. Intense jewel tones, earthy colors, and geometric prints can include vibrancy and character to a room.

4. Multi-Functional Furniture

In a period where space is often at a premium, lots of contemporary sofas now double as beds or consist of storage compartments. Sofa beds, futons, and sectional sofas with built-in storage are useful services for small home.

5. Vintage Inspiration

Today's contemporary sofas often include retro designs that evoke fond memories. Vintage-inspired elements such as tufting, rounded edges, and vibrant patterns are making a return, adding character to modern interiors.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How do I pick the best size sofa for my space?

Procedure the designated location and guarantee you think about the scale of the space and other furniture. Leave enough area for movement and think about the sofa's height to match the other pieces in the room.

2. What is the typical life expectancy of a modern sofa?

Usually, a well-made sofa can last in between 7 to 15 years, depending on the products and use. High-quality leather sofas can last even longer with appropriate care.

3. Should I focus on comfort or design when selecting a sofa?

It ultimately depends upon your lifestyle. If the sofa will be utilized frequently, convenience should be a top priority. However, you can discover choices that integrate both comfort and design successfully.

4. How often should I clean my sofa?

Regular vacuuming and area cleaning are vital. Deep cleansing should be done according to the product's requirements-- generally as soon as or twice a year.

5. Is it worth buying a higher-end sofa?

Purchasing a higher-end sofa can be rewarding, particularly if you prioritize sturdiness and convenience. Quality sofas often settle in the long run through longevity and much better style.
